Jason Ader's track record is rooted in one consistent advantage: concentration in gaming and hospitality rather than generic market exposure. That focus began at Bear Stearns, continued through Las Vegas Sands board service, and later informed SpringOwl's investment work.
Bear Stearns foundation
Ten consecutive years as the top-ranked gaming and lodging analyst created the analytical base for later capital-allocation decisions.
Board governance perspective
Las Vegas Sands board service added operating, regulatory, and governance context across one of the industry's most visible public companies.
SpringOwl investing
SpringOwl applied that experience to public-company situations tied to value creation, market structure, and digital-gaming transition.
